The rated cable pulling tension shall not be exceeded. Cable shall not be
stressed such that twisting, stretching or kinking occurs. Cable shall not
be spliced. Cable not in a wireway shall be suspended a minimum of [200]
[_____] mm [8] [_____] inches above ceilings by cable supports no greater
than [1.5] [_____] m [60] [_____] inches apart. Cable shall not be run
through structural members or in contact with pipes, ducts, or other
potentially damaging items. Placement of cable parallel to power
conductors shall be avoided, if possible; a minimum separation of 300 mm 12
inches shall be maintained when such placement cannot be avoided. Cables
shall be terminated unless shown otherwise. Minimum bending radius shall
not be exceeded during installation or once installed. Cable ties shall
not be excessively tightened such that the transmission characteristics of
the cable are altered. In raised floor areas, cable shall be installed
after the flooring system has been installed. Cable [1.8] [_____] m [6]
[_____] feet long shall be neatly coiled not less than [300] [_____] mm
[12] [_____] inches in diameter below each feed point in raised floor areas.
3.1.2
Riser Cable Installation
The rated cable pulling tension shall not be exceeded. Riser cable support
intervals shall be in accordance with manufacturer's recommendations.
Cable bend radius shall not be less than ten times the outside diameter of
the cable during installation and once installed. Maximum tensile strength
rating of the cable shall not be exceeded. Cable shall not be spliced.
3.1.3
Outlets
3.1.3.1
Each faceplate shall be labeled with its function and a unique number to
identify the cable run.
3.1.3.2
Cables
Cables shall have a minimum of 150 mm 6 inches of slack cable loosely
coiled into the cable television outlet boxes. Minimum manufacturer's bend
radius shall not be exceeded.
3.1.3.3
Pull Cords
Pull cords shall be installed in conduits serving the cable television
premises distribution system which do not initially have cable installed.
